Specify the difference between microeconomics and macroeconomics.
| Microeconomics | Macroeconomics |
| $1.$ Microeconorpjcsis. the study and analysis of economics at an individual, group or company level. | $1.$ Macroeconomics is the study of national economy as a whole. |
| $2.$ Macroeconomic analysis uses the ‘Principc of Marginalism to analyze how individual units make decisions in an economy. | $2.$ Macroeconomic analysis has helped to develop principles for managing resources in such a way that leads to increase in national income, reduce unemployment, poverty, inflation and so on. |
| $3.$ Determining price and wages. equilibrium output level for firm. etc. are studied here. | $3.$ Macroccanomics studies determining national income, unemployment, poverty, etc. |
